As long as you've attached this iso to the guest's DVD drive and made
that drive bootable before the disk drive, this looks like it should
boot. The only other possibility I can think of is you're trying to
install a 64 bit windows 10 on a guest configured as 32 bit. Other
than that I'm out of ideas.
